On 04/03/2014 04:20 AM, Prabhakar Kushwaha wrote:
> T1040RDB and T1042RDB_PI has CPLD. Here CPLD controls board mux/features.
> 
> This support of CPLD includes
>  - files and register defintion
>  - Commands to swtich alternate bank and default bank
